An ultrasound likewise called a sonogram assists your medical professional figure out whether the fetus is creating usually. Your doctor might suggest that you have 1 or even more ultrasounds at various points in your maternity. It can be made use of to examine the makeup of the fetus for defects or problems. Relying on just how much along your pregnancy is, ultrasound pictures aid your medical professional: estimate your due day check things like the dimension and position of the fetus to ensure everything is typical see the position of the placenta see the amount of amniotic liquid in your womb locate numerous pregnancies (twins, triplets, and so on) Ultrasounds can likewise be utilized to evaluate for sure birth flaws, like Down syndrome.

Fetal ultrasound is a test done throughout pregnancy that utilizes shown audio waves. The photo is presented on a TV display. It may be in black and white or in colour.
The 5-Minute Rule for Babyecho
It does not make use of X-rays or various other sorts of radiation that might hurt your fetus. It can be done as early as the 5th week of maternity. In some cases the sex of your fetus can be seen by concerning the 18th week of maternity. Ultrasound is among the screening tests that might be performed in the very first trimester to search for abnormality, such as Down syndrome.
Quote the age of the fetus (gestational age). Price quote the threat of a chromosome flaw, such as Down syndrome. Look for abnormality that impact the mind or spine. This examination is done to: Quote the age of the fetus. Look at the dimension and position of the unborn child, placenta, and amniotic fluid.
